BIOS: differenze tra le versioni
Contenuto cancellato Contenuto aggiunto
Errore di battitura su Chernobyl virus |
|||
(19 versioni intermedie di 13 utenti non mostrate) | |||
Riga 1:
{{nd||Bios}}
[[File:Elitegroup 761GX-M754 - AMIBIOS (American Megatrends) in a Winbond W39V040APZ-5491.jpg|
==
Quando verso la fine degli [[anni 1970]] Intel e IBM iniziarono a produrre i primi PC basati sul processore 8088 alla fine, Intel stipulò un accordo con Microsoft per la messa a punto di un sistema operativo. Microsoft decise di dividere il sistema operativo in due parti, la prima che comprendeva le operazioni di base per far dialogare le componenti hardware del PC e che risiedeva in un chip di memoria ROM (''[[Read Only Memory]]''). La seconda parte del sistema operativo risiedeva su un floppy disk e veniva caricato ad ogni avvio del PC ed era composto da un insieme di programmi che interfacciavano il computer con l'utente permettendo di svolgere una serie di operazioni di base. La Intel decise allora di sviluppare in modo indipendente le due parti: la prima fu chiamata BIOS e la seconda DOS (acronimo di ''Disk Operative System'').
Riga 12:
== Descrizione ==
Si tratta di un insieme di [[subroutine|routine software]], generalmente scritte su memoria [[Read Only Memory|ROM]], [[Memoria Flash|FLASH]] o altra [[memoria (informatica)|memoria]] non volatile ([[firmware]])<ref group="N">Il firmware (contenuto in uno specifico chip della scheda madre) è un programma diverso dal
L'operazione di aggiornamento (''flash'' in inglese) richiede cautela poiché, qualora non andasse a buon fine, a causa di un [[black out]] per esempio, o altri inconvenienti elettrici, potrebbe rendere inutilizzabile la [[scheda madre]]<ref group="N">I
L'acronimo apparve per la prima volta con il sistema operativo [[CP/M]] e descriveva quella parte di CP/M che veniva caricata all'avvio, che si interfacciava direttamente con l'hardware. I computer che utilizzavano il CP/M avevano infatti soltanto un ''boot loader'' nella [[Read-Only Memory|ROM]]. Anche le successive versioni del [[MS-DOS|DOS]] avevano un file, nominato ''IBMBIO.COM'' o ''IO.SYS'' del tutto analoghi. == Funzionamento ==
=== Avvio del PC ===
A partire dall'introduzione dei primi [[IBM PC XT]] e compatibili nell'agosto del [[1981]], il BIOS ha il compito di dare, durante la fase di avvio, detta ''[[boot|boot process]]'', i primi comandi al sistema. In questa fase, dopo i controlli preliminari sulla funzionalità dei componenti fondamentali ([[interrupt]], [[RAM]], [[tastiera (informatica)|tastiera]], [[disco rigido|dischi]], [[porta (informatica)|porte]]), per elencare e inizializzare correttamente le periferiche presenti, il BIOS legge alcuni parametri, come l'ora e la data corrente, da una piccola memoria RAM [[CMOS]]<ref group="N">Sovente, si fa confusione tra BIOS e CMOS. Il BIOS è il [[firmware]] contenuto nell'omonimo [[circuito integrato]]; il CMOS è un chip di memoria che contiene i parametri di configurazione processati dal BIOS durante la sua esecuzione, in un dato momento del [[Power-on self-test|POST]] nel [[boot]]. Questi dati sono: data e ora; a seconda della scheda madre potrebbero essere anche i parametri di configurazione [[Hardware|HD]] del sistema che comunque vengono in massima parte rilevati e ri-memorizzati in automatico dal
Nelle moderne [[implementazione|implementazioni]] del BIOS possono essere selezionati differenti tipi di supporto per l'avvio e sono presenti numerose funzioni per la diagnostica e la personalizzazione di importanti funzioni relative all'utilizzo della RAM, alle opzioni per l'[[overclocking]] e sono presenti segnali acustici di allarme in caso di malfunzionamenti delle [[ventola|ventole]] atte al raffreddamento del CPU o l'eccessivo aumento della [[temperatura]] generale dell'intera scheda madre.
Riga 31 ⟶ 33:
Ciò permette di caricare un sistema operativo diverso da quello previsto dall'[[amministratore di sistema]], e quindi di eludere qualsiasi politica di sicurezza basata sul sistema operativo già installato.
== Compiti principali ==
Il BIOS assolve diversi compiti. Prima di tutto, mette a disposizione le funzioni base di un computer e dopo ogni suo avvio si assicura che le componenti principali come memoria, CPU e altre componenti dell’hardware funzionino correttamente, effettuando un test Power on Self Test (POST). Inoltre permette di risolvere un problema principale dei computer, perché ogni software deve prima essere caricato nella memoria principale per essere avviato. Per fare ciò, deve essere comunicata la posizione di quel programma e questo ruolo viene assunto dal BIOS in qualità di firmware, che funge anche da intermediario tra CPU e software. Con il tempo le funzioni del BIOS sono ulteriormente aumentate. È diventato importante anche per la gestione energetica del computer, controlla la funzionalità di dischi rigidi integrati o di altri supporti esterni e permette di configurare la successione con cui richiamare i dispositivi di memorizzazione.<ref>{{Cita web|url=https://www.ionos.it/digitalguide/server/know-how/cose-il-bios/|titolo=Cos’è il BIOS?|accesso=16 maggio 2022}}</ref>
== Configurazione ==
=== Accesso e navigazione tra le schede ===
[[File:Award BIOS setup utility.png|
L'accesso al menu del BIOS avviene premendo un tasto o una combinazione di tasti, che variano tra produttori e modelli, durante la fase di [[Power-on self-test|POST]]. Alcune combinazioni utilizzate sono<ref>[http://www.navigaweb.net/2008/07/come-accedere-al-bios-sui-computer-di.html Come accedere al BIOS sui computer di tutte le marche - Pom-HeyWEB!<!-- Titolo generato automaticamente -->]</ref>:▼
▲L'accesso al menu del BIOS avviene premendo un tasto o una combinazione di tasti, che variano tra produttori e modelli, durante la fase di [[Power-on self-test|POST]]. Alcune combinazioni utilizzate sono<ref>[http://www.navigaweb.net/2008/07/come-accedere-al-bios-sui-computer-di.html Come accedere al BIOS sui computer di tutte le marche - Pom-HeyWEB!<!-- Titolo generato automaticamente -->]</ref>:
*{{tasto|Canc}}
*{{tasto|F1}}
Riga 47 ⟶ 52:
In seguito, ad esempio, sono riportati i tasti da premere sui dispositivi di alcuni produttori:
* Acer: {{tasto|Canc}} o {{tasto|F2}}
* Asus: {{tasto|F2}}
Riga 53 ⟶ 57:
* Lenovo: {{tasto|F1}} o {{tasto|F2}}
* HP: {{tasto|F1}}, {{tasto|F2}}, {{tasto|F10}}, {{tasto|Esc}} o {{tasto|Canc}}
* Dell: {{tasto|F2}} o {{tasto|F12}}
La navigazione visiva fra le schede nelle impostazioni del BIOS avviene da tastiera tramite tasti direzionali sulle schede madri per computer normali, mentre avviene tramite mouse e tastiera sulle schede madri per pc con [[Unified Extensible Firmware Interface|UEFI]] al posto del
=== Save to disk ===
Su alcuni vecchi
=== BIOS riprogrammabile ===
Il BIOS è il [[firmware]] del computer, pur essendo composto da istruzioni [[software]], è una parte integrante dell'hardware. Prima del 1990, il BIOS veniva memorizzato su una o più [[Read only memory|ROM]], non riprogrammabili. Con l'aumentare della complessità, di pari passo con la necessità di aggiornamenti, si è diffusa la memorizzazione del firmware BIOS dapprima su [[EPROM]], poi su [[EEPROM]] o [[flash memory]], per permettere un rapido aggiornamento anche dall'utente inesperto. L'esistenza di BIOS aggiornabili dall'utente finale, permette di ottenere il supporto per [[CPU]] più aggiornate o per dischi fissi più capienti. Per effettuare tali operazioni è indispensabile consultare il manuale d'uso fornito con la [[scheda madre]], il [[sito web]] del produttore o entrambe le modalità.
Giacché eventuali errori nell'aggiornamento del BIOS rendono il computer inutilizzabile, alcune schede madri sono dotate di un doppio BIOS che consente di ripristinarne l'uso della macchina a seguito di una riprogrammazione erronea. Sono noti alcuni [[Virus (informatica)|virus]] in grado di sovrascrivere il BIOS (come il famigerato [[CIH (virus)|CIH o
== Epilogo ==
Con l'avvento del firmware basato su tecnologia [[UEFI]] e la successiva introduzione sul mercato (all'incirca a partire dal 2010), il BIOS, inteso come vecchia interfaccia utente del firmware, è stato destinato a progressivi rimpiazzi e quindi alla definitiva uscita di scena<ref>{{Cita news|lingua=it-IT|url=http://www.smartworld.it/informatica/intel-abbandono-legacy-bios-2020.html|titolo=Addio BIOS, UEFI ha trionfato: Intel rimuoverà il supporto all'avvio Legacy nel 2020|pubblicazione=SmartWorld|data=2017-11-24|accesso=2018-03-24}}</ref>.
Alcuni sistemi operativi
== Note ==
;Annotazioni
<references group="N"/>
;Fonti
<references/>
== Bibliografia ==
*{{Cita testo|titolo=Funzioni DOS e BIOS|url=https://archive.org/details/funzionidosebios|autore=Que Corporation|editore=Gruppo Editoriale Jackson|anno=1990|ISBN=88-256-0117-4}}
*{{Cita testo|lingua=en|titolo=The BIOS Companion|url=https://archive.org/details/TheBiosCompanion_905|autore=Phil Croucher|editore=|anno=2004|ISBN=0-9681928-0-7}}
Riga 91 ⟶ 98:
== Altri progetti ==
{{interprogetto|wikt|preposizione=sul}}
== Collegamenti esterni ==
*{{collegamenti esterni}}
* {{FOLDOC|Basic Input/Output System|Basic Input/Output System}}
* {{Garzanti}}
*{{cita web|url=http://www.hwmaster.com/forum/significato-beep-bios-t608.html|titolo=Significato Beep Bios|autore=Mirko185|data=10 aprile 2011|sito=Hardware Master Forum|accesso=28 settembre 2020|urlmorto=sì|urlarchivio=https://web.archive.org/web/20160324005123/http://www.hwmaster.com/forum/significato-beep-bios-t608.html}}
|